Cops: 1 dead, 1 critical after shooting in downtown Chicago high-rise
CHICAGO — Chicago police report one person is dead and another critical after a shooting inside a downtown high-rise office building.
Police spokesman Martin Maloney says the two people were shot this morning. No other details were immediately released, but an officer came out of the building in the city’s business district saying the situation was contained around 10:40 a.m.
A worker in the building says building security sent an email around 10 a.m. saying there was a security situation in the lobby and asking them to stay at their desks.
Crime scene tape is now cordoning off the Bank of America building, where shooting occurred. Dozens of workers from other buildings in the area are gathering outside.
